What is a full time software engineer 300k?

A Full Time Software Engineer 300K refers to a software engineering professional who works full-time and earns a total compensation package around $300,000 per year. This compensation typically includes base salary, bonuses, and stock options or equity, and is most commonly found at large tech companies, investment firms, or high-growth startups. Achieving this level of pay usually requires several years of experience, strong technical skills, and sometimes working in high-cost-of-living areas like Silicon Valley or New York City. Responsibilities include designing, developing, testing, and maintaining software systems, often collaborating with cross-functional teams.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a full time software engineer?

To excel as a Full Time Software Engineer, you need strong programming skills (such as proficiency in languages like Python, Java, or C++), a solid understanding of computer science fundamentals, and typically a bachelor’s deg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with development tools, version control systems (e.g., Git), cloud platforms, and possibly certifications like AWS Certified Developer or Microsoft Certified: Azure Developer Associate is often expected. Excellent problem-solving abilities, collaboration, and effective communication skills help engineers work efficiently within teams and adapt to evolving project requirements. These competencies are crucial for delivering robust, scalable solutions and succeeding in high-performing engineering environments.

What does collaboration typically look like for a full time software engineer in high-compensation roles?

As a Full Time Software Engineer in a high-compensation role, such as at top tech companies, you'll frequently collaborate with cross-functional teams including product managers, designers, and data scientists. Agile methodologies are often used, requiring regular stand-ups, sprint planning, and code reviews. Strong communication skills are essential, as you'll be expected to both contribute technical expertise and align your work with broader business goals. It's common to partner with senior engineers or tech leads on complex projects, ensuring high standards in code quality and system architecture.
